Price to install manic stage 1 tune

Hey, I am looking into installing a manic stage 1 tune. How much does it cost to get it installed from an authorized manic dealer?

It's 500$ plus 199$ if you want the sps switch. I had to pay tax on top of that so it was like $750 for the switch and the tune. I would recommend getting the switch so you can switch maps and change it back to stock of you go to the dealer

Do the N18, 2012 MCS motors run too lean in stock form? I just picked up a 2012 and have put an AFE hi flow dry filter and am just starting to read about Manic Tunes. I live in Maine so no one really close to me.

Stock I was seeing low 14's WOT around midrange, it worked its way down to 13's, then low 12's close to redline.
With Manic tune I see low 12's at just about any rpm range.
